/***
* A plugin to add row detail panel
* Original StackOverflow question & article making this possible (thanks to violet313)
* https://stackoverflow.com/questions/10535164/can-slickgrids-row-height-be-dynamically-altered#29399927
* http://violet313.org/slickgrids/#intro
*
* USAGE:
* Add the slick.rowDetailView.(js|css) files and register the plugin with the grid.
*
* AVAILABLE ROW DETAIL OPTIONS:
* cssClass: A CSS class to be added to the row detail
* expandedClass: Extra classes to be added to the expanded Toggle
* expandableOverride: callback method that user can override the default behavior of making every row an expandable row (the logic to show or not the expandable icon).
* collapsedClass: Extra classes to be added to the collapse Toggle
* loadOnce: Defaults to false, when set to True it will load the data once and then reuse it.
* preTemplate: Template that will be used before the async process (typically used to show a spinner/loading)
* postTemplate: Template that will be loaded once the async function finishes
* process: Async server function call
* panelRows: Row count to use for the template panel
* singleRowExpand: Defaults to false, limit expanded row to 1 at a time.
* useRowClick: Boolean flag, when True will open the row detail on a row click (from any column), default to False
* keyPrefix: Defaults to '_', prefix used for all the plugin metadata added to the item object (meta e.g.: padding, collapsed, parent)
* collapseAllOnSort: Defaults to true, which will collapse all row detail views when user calls a sort. Unless user implements a sort to deal with padding
* saveDetailViewOnScroll: Defaults to true, which will save the row detail view in a cache when it detects that it will become out of the viewport buffer
* useSimpleViewportCalc: Defaults to false, which will use simplified calculation of out or back of viewport visibility
*
* AVAILABLE PUBLIC METHODS:
* init: initiliaze the plugin
* expandableOverride: callback method that user can override the default behavior of making every row an expandable row (the logic to show or not the expandable icon).
* destroy: destroy the plugin and it's events
* collapseAll: collapse all opened row detail panel
* collapseDetailView: collapse a row by passing the item object (row detail)
* expandDetailView: expand a row by passing the item object (row detail)
* getColumnDefinition: get the column definitions
* getExpandedRows: get all the expanded rows
* getFilterItem: takes in the item we are filtering and if it is an expanded row returns it's parents row to filter on
* getOptions: get current plugin options
* resizeDetailView: resize a row detail view, it will auto-calculate the number of rows it needs
* saveDetailView: save a row detail view content by passing the row object
* setOptions: set or change some of the plugin options
*
* THE PLUGIN EXPOSES THE FOLLOWING SLICK EVENTS:
* onAsyncResponse: This event must be used with the "notify" by the end user once the Asynchronous Server call returns the item detail
* Event args:
* item: Item detail returned from the async server call
* detailView: An explicit view to use instead of template (Optional)
*
* onAsyncEndUpdate: Fired when the async response finished
* Event args:
* grid: Reference to the grid.
* item: Item data context
*
* onBeforeRowDetailToggle: Fired before the row detail gets toggled
* Event args:
* grid: Reference to the grid.
* item: Item data context
*
* onAfterRowDetailToggle: Fired after the row detail gets toggled
* Event args:
* grid: Reference to the grid.
* item: Item data context
* expandedRows: Array of the Expanded Rows
*
* onRowOutOfViewportRange: Fired after a row becomes out of viewport range (user can't see the row anymore)
* Event args:
* grid: Reference to the grid.
* item: Item data context
* rowId: Id of the Row object (datacontext) in the Grid
* rowIndex: Index of the Row in the Grid
* expandedRows: Array of the Expanded Rows
* rowIdsOutOfViewport: Array of the Out of viewport Range Rows
*
* onRowBackToViewportRange: Fired after the row detail gets toggled
* Event args:
* grid: Reference to the grid.
* item: Item data context
* rowId: Id of the Row object (datacontext) in the Grid
* rowIndex: Index of the Row in the Grid
* expandedRows: Array of the Expanded Rows
* rowIdsOutOfViewport: Array of the Out of viewport Range Rows
*/
